Гость
Целевая тема:
Создать новую тему:
Автор:
Форумы / HTML, JavaScript, VBScript, CSS [игнор отключен] [закрыт для гостей] / Помогите новичку / 6 сообщений из 6, страница 1 из 1
10.07.2008, 13:38
    #35422854
Valencia
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Помогите новичку
Мне нужно на onClick у тега SELECT нарисовать картинку, как это можно сделать?

Я делаю так

<script language="javascript">;
function dataSelect(f) {
f.write("<img src="'PREVIEW.GIF'">")
}
</script>

<th><style=vertical-align: right><input type="submit" value="Далее" onClick="dataSelect(this.form)"></th>

Но картинка не рисуется.
...
Рейтинг: 0 / 0
10.07.2008, 13:55
    #35422921
krvsa
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Помогите новичку
Не совсем понял "тестовый" пример... Ребята учитесь таки их делать.

Как вариант...

Код: plaintext
1.
2.
3.
4.
5.
6.
7.
8.
9.
10.
11.
12.
13.
14.
15.
16.
17.
18.
19.
20.
<html>
<head>
<style type='text/css'>
#scr {
	visibility: hidden;
}
</style>
<script language='javascript'>
function Go() {
	var obj=document.getElementById('scr')
	obj.src='картинка.jpg'
	obj.style.visibility='visible'
}
</script>
</head>
<body>
<img src='' id='scr' />
<br />
<input type='button' value='Go' onclick='Go()'>
</body>
</html>
----------
Cache for Windows (x86-32) 2007.1.3 (Build 607) Wed Oct 17 2007 02:12:09 EDT
...
Рейтинг: 0 / 0
10.07.2008, 13:56
    #35422924
vkle
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Помогите новичку
Сделать тэг img с требуемыми размерами и заглушкой типа src="1x1.gif" там где надо, назначить ему id, а по onclick менять src на нужную картинку.
Posted via ActualForum NNTP Server 1.4
...
Рейтинг: 0 / 0
10.07.2008, 14:05
    #35422960
Valencia
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Помогите новичку
Спасибо, все получилось
...
Рейтинг: 0 / 0
10.07.2008, 14:15
    #35423015
illion
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Помогите новичку
krvsaНе совсем понял "тестовый" пример...
+1. Пример и впрямь отпадный. Над таким еще постараться надо, чтоб сочинить.
Valencia
Мне нужно на onClick у тега SELECT нарисовать картинку...
<script language="javascript">;
function dataSelect(f) {
f.write("<img src="'PREVIEW.GIF'">")
}
</script>
<th><style=vertical-align: right><input type="submit" value="Далее" onClick="dataSelect(this.form)"></th>

У формы нет метода write.
Что значит "у тега SELECT нарисовать картинку"? "У тега" - это где именно?
Где форма? Где select?
Что за новый тег <style=vertical-align: right> и как можно выравнять по вертикали направо?
Почему input type="submit", а не input type="button"?
В каком-то совершенно загадочном месте в скрипте появилась точка с запятой.

krvsa
Код: plaintext
1.
visibility: hidden;

наверное лучше display:none. Больше будет похоже на отрисовку картинки (если задача действительно такая), а то ведь visibility пустое место оставляет.
...
Рейтинг: 0 / 0
10.07.2008, 14:22
    #35423044
krvsa
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Помогите новичку
illionнаверное лучше display:none.
Зависит от ситуации...
...
Рейтинг: 0 / 0
Форумы / HTML, JavaScript, VBScript, CSS [игнор отключен] [закрыт для гостей] / Помогите новичку / 6 сообщений из 6, страница 1 из 1
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]